:root,:host{--color-ptc-text:#333}@layer components{.ptc-content{color:var(--color-ptc-text);letter-spacing:.025em;background-color:#f6f7fa;font-size:17px;line-height:1.8}.ptc-content h1{font-size:var(--text-4xl);font-weight:var(--font-weight-semibold);line-height:var(--leading-tight);margin-bottom:calc(var(--spacing)*6)}.ptc-content h2{font-size:var(--text-2xl);font-weight:var(--font-weight-semibold);line-height:var(--leading-snug);margin-top:calc(var(--spacing)*12);margin-bottom:calc(var(--spacing)*4)}.ptc-content h3{font-size:var(--text-xl);font-weight:var(--font-weight-semibold);line-height:var(--leading-snug);margin-top:calc(var(--spacing)*8);margin-bottom:calc(var(--spacing)*6)}.ptc-content p{margin-bottom:calc(var(--spacing)*6)}.ptc-content ul{padding-left:calc(var(--spacing)*6);margin-bottom:calc(var(--spacing)*6);list-style-type:disc}.ptc-content li{margin-bottom:calc(var(--spacing)*1)}.ptc-content a{color:#3b82f6;text-decoration:underline}.ptc-content a:hover{text-decoration:none}.ptc-content img{border-radius:var(--radius-2xl)}.ptc-card{margin-bottom:calc(var(--spacing)*10)}.ptc-content:has(.ptc-home){background-color:#0000}@media (max-width:767px){.ptc-content h1{font-size:var(--text-3xl)}}}
